What does TBH mean in slang texting?

“Tbh,” the acronym that stands for “to be honest,” has taken on a different meaning since it was first adopted by teens. The Washington Post recently profiled a 13-year-old girl and focused on her social-media use. She explained that on Instagram, a “tbh” is used to say something nice about your friends.

How do you give a tbh on Instagram?

“[You] post a picture saying something like ‘like for a tbh or comment for a tbh,'” Sammy says. After they get their like, comment, or follow, the teen will then go to give a tbh on a user’s last post or direct message them on the app, she explains.

What does LBH mean in texting?

This is similar to the terms JBH, which stands for just being honest, TBBH, which stands for to be brutally honest, TBTH, which means to be totally honest, and LBH, which stands for let’s be honest, per McAfee. This can be used at the beginning of a sentence or the end of a sentence, and rarely in the middle of a sentence.
